How they compare

Georgia currently reports 1,897 real chained 2019 US$ against 1,749 real chained 2019 US$ in Montenegro, a difference of 148 real chained 2019 US$.

That makes Georgia's figure about 1.1 times Montenegro's.

The two have swapped places 1 time across 14 shared years of data; in 2007 it was Montenegro ahead.

Georgia ranks 117th and Montenegro ranks 120th of 151 countries.

Across the 3 decades both report, Georgia averaged higher in 1 and Montenegro in 2.

Natural capital includes the valuation of renewable and nonrenewable natural capital. Renewable natural capital includes agricultural land (cropland and pastureland), forests (timber, and three ecosystem services: water, recretion and non-wood forest products), protected areas, mangroves and fisheries. Nonrenewable natural capital includes fossil fuel energy (oil, gas, hard and soft coal) and minerals (bauxite, copper, gold, iron ore, lead, nickel, phosphate, silver, tin, and zinc),Values are measured at market exchange rates in constant 2018 US dollars, using a country-specific GDP deflator.
